Just installed a cam and I'm having trouble with the car running bad. The car runs fine (for a couple of minutes) if you start it after it has been sitting all night. But then it starts to have a slight miss and a poping sound, not a back fire out of the exhaust?? Now it is really obvious when you try taking off in first gear. I ran a scan on it and the only thing that I can see that dosn't look right is that at idle my spark advance is 24 and once I start to push on the gas to go it jumps to 45 and is maxed out it looks like. Could this be causing this problem? Can or should I bump up the max timing with tunercat? I've already done all of the basic things such as plugs and wires. The wires are all in the right position. The timing chain is lined up dot to dot. I'm about fed up. Will the dealership be able to see more on their computer than what I'm seeing with freescan and datamaster??? Thanks
